package zap
import (
"encoding/binary"
"fmt"
"math"
"github.com/blevesearch/bleve/index/scorch/segment/zap"
"github.com/couchbase/vellum"
"github.com/spf13/cobra"
)
// dictCmd represents the dict command
var dictCmd = &cobra.Command{
Use: "dict [path] [field]",
Short: "dict prints the term dictionary for the specified field",
Long: `The dict command lets you print the term dictionary for the specified field.`,
RunE: func(cmd *cobra.Command, args []string) error {
if len(args) < 2 {
return fmt.Errorf("must specify field")
}
data := segment.Data()
addr, err := segment.DictAddr(args[1])
if err != nil {
return fmt.Errorf("error determing address: %v", err)
}
fmt.Printf("dictionary for field starts at %d (%x)\n", addr, addr)
vellumLen, read := binary.Uvarint(data[addr : addr+binary.MaxVarintLen64])
fmt.Printf("vellum length: %d\n", vellumLen)
fstBytes := data[addr+uint64(read) : addr+uint64(read)+vellumLen]
fmt.Printf("raw vellum data % x\n", fstBytes)
fmt.Printf("dictionary:\n\n")
if fstBytes != nil {
fst, err := vellum.Load(fstBytes)
if err != nil {
return fmt.Errorf("dictionary field %s vellum err: %v", args[1], err)
}
itr, err := fst.Iterator(nil, nil)
for err == nil {
currTerm, currVal := itr.Current()
extra := ""
if currVal&zap.FSTValEncodingMask == zap.FSTValEncoding1Hit {
docNum, normBits := zap.FSTValDecode1Hit(currVal)
norm := math.Float32frombits(uint32(normBits))
extra = fmt.Sprintf("-- docNum: %d, norm: %f", docNum, norm)
}
fmt.Printf("%s - %d (%x) %s\n", currTerm, currVal, currVal, extra)
err = itr.Next()
}
if err != nil && err != vellum.ErrIteratorDone {
return fmt.Errorf("error iterating dictionary: %v", err)
}
}
return nil
},
}
func init() {
RootCmd.AddCommand(dictCmd)
}
